You're done.Resuming a Downloaded Assignment on BigIdeasMath.com. Students will lose any unsaved progress that has not been uploaded if they resume the assignment at BigIdeasMath.com. Upload the assignment in the app before resuming online at BigIdeasMath.com to avoid losing any work. HW App icon When a student has …

Founded in 2008 by renowned math textbook author, Dr. Ron Larson, Big Ideas Learning creates cohesive, content-rich, and rigorous mathematics curriculum ranging from kindergarten through high school.
